Indications
Protein supply for parenteral nutrition. Prophylaxis & therapy of protein deficiency resulting from increased protein losses &/or increased protein requirements.
Adult Dose
Adults:
10-20 mL/kg body wt (equiv to 1-2 g amino acids/kg body wt). Max infusion rate: 1 mL/kg body wt/hr (equiv to 0.1 g amino acid/kg body wt & hr).
Max daily dose: 20 mL/kg body wt (equiv to 2 g amino acid/kg body wt).
Child Dose
Infants and Children:
In children and infants, the rate of infusion is 28-35 ml/kg body wt/day is recommended, with a stepwise increment in the rate of administration during the first week of treatment.
Renal Dose
Patients with renal impairment not needing dialysis require 0.6 to 0.8 g of protein/kg/day.
Patients on hemodialysis or continuous renal replacement therapy should receive 1.2 to 1.8 g of protein/kg/day up to a maximum of 2.5 g of protein/kg/day based on nutritional status and estimated protein losses.
Elderly Dose
Clinical studies with amino acids have not been performed to determine whether subjects aged 65 and over respond differently from other younger subjects. Other reported clinical experience has not identified differences in responses between the elderly and younger patients.
In general, dose selection for an elderly patient should be cautious, usually starting at the low end of the dosing range, reflecting the greater frequency of decreased hepatic, renal, or cardiac function, and of concomitant disease or drug therapy.
Hepatic Dose
In patients with impaired liver function, parenteral nutrition solutions containing amino acids should be administered starting at the low end of the dosing range.
Frequent clinical evaluation and laboratory tests to monitor liver function such as bilirubin and liver function parameters should be conducted
Administration
Depending upon patients requirements, 1000-2000 ml amino acid may be infused intravenously per 24 hours. It should be infused slowly, at rates 1.4-2.8 ml (30-60 drops) per minute.
Contra Indications
Contraindicated in patients with inborn errors of amino acids metabolism. Moreover, amino acid should not be used in patients with hepatic coma or metabolic disorders involving impaired nitrogen utilization.
Precautions
Pulmonary Embolism due to Pulmonary Vascular Precipitates: if signs of pulmonary distress occur, stop the infusion and initiate a medical evaluation.
Hypersensitivity Reactions.
Risk of Infections, Refeeding Complications, and Hyperglycemia or Hyperosmolar Hyperglycemic State
Vein Damage and Thrombosis: solutions with osmolarity of 900 mOsm/L or more must be infused through a central catheter.
Hepatobiliary Disorders.
Aluminum Toxicity: increased risk in patients with renal impairment, including preterm infants.
Parenteral Nutrition Associated Liver Disease: increased risk in patients who receive parenteral nutrition for extended periods of time, especially preterm infants; monitor liver function tests, if abnormalities occur consider discontinuation or dosage reduction.
Electrolyte Imbalance and Fluid Overload: patients with cardiac insufficiency or renal impairment may require adjustment of fluid, protein and electrolyte content.

Pregnancy-Lactation
Not Classi
Risk Summary
Limited published data with injectable amino acids solutions, in pregnant women are not sufficient to inform a drug associated risk for adverse developmental outcomes.
However, malnutrition in pregnant women is associated with adverse maternal and fetal outcomes. Animal reproduction studies have not been conducted with injectable amino acids solutions.
The background risk of major birth defects and miscarriage for the indicated population is unknown.
All pregnancies have a background risk of birth defect, loss, or other adverse outcomes.
However, the background risk in the U.S. general population of major birth defects is 2 to 4% and ofmiscarriage is 15 to 20% of clinically recognized pregnancies.
Clinical Considerations
Disease-Associated Maternal and/or Embryo-Fetal Risk
Severe malnutrition in pregnant women is associated with preterm delivery, low birth weight, intrauterine growth restriction, congenital malformations and perinatal mortality. Parenteral nutrition should be considered if a pregnant woman’s nutritional requirements cannot be fulfilled by oral or enteral intake.
Lactation
Risk Summary
There are no data available to assess the presence of injectable amino acids, in human milk, the effects of amino acids on the breastfed infant or the effects on milk production.
The lack of clinical data during lactation precludes a clear determination of the risk of amino acids to a child during lactation; therefore, the developmental and health benefits of breastfeeding should be considered along with the mother’s clinical need for amino acids and any potential adverse effects on the breastfed child from amino acids or from the underlying maternal condition.

Mechanism of Action
A crystalline amino acid solution provides crystalline amino acids to promote protein synthesis and wound healing, and to reduce the rate of endogenous protein catabolism. Amino Acids, given by central venous infusion in combination with concentrated dextrose, electrolytes, vitamins, trace metals, and ancillary fat supplements, constitute total parenteral nutrition (TPN). Amino Acids can also be administered by peripheral vein with dextrose and maintenance electrolytes.
